Flow Cytometry - Anti-KIR2DL1 + KIR2DL2 antibody [EPR22492-2] - BSA and Azide free (AB255806)
Flow cytometric analysis of human PBMCs (peripheral blood mononuclear cells) labeling KIR2DL1 + KIR2DL2 with ab224696 at 1/60 dilution (Right) compared with Recombinant Rabbit IgG, monoclonal [EPR25A] - Isotype Control (ab172730) (Left).
Goat Anti-Rabbit IgG Fc (Alexa Fluor® 488) preadsorbed (ab150097), at 1/5000 dilution was used as the secondary antibody.
Cells were stained with rabbit IgG (Left) or ab224696 (Right). Then stained with anti-CD56 conjugated to BV421.
Gated on viable cells.
This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(ab224696).

Immunohistochemistry (Formalin/PFA-fixed paraffin-embedded sections) - Anti-KIR2DL1 + KIR2DL2 antibody [EPR22492-2] - BSA and Azide free (AB255806)
Immunohistochemical analysis of paraffin-embedded human endometrium tissue labeling KIR2DL1 + KIR2DL2 with ab224696 at 1/1000 dilution, followed by Goat Anti-Rabbit IgG H&L (HRP) ready to use. Positive staining in natural killer (NK) cells in human endometrium (PMID : 7749980) is observed. Counterstained with hematoxylin.
Secondary antibody only control : Used PBS instead of primary antibody, secondary antibody is Goat Anti-Rabbit IgG H&L (HRP) ready to use.
Heat mediated antigen retrieval using ab93684 (Tris/EDTA buffer, pH 9.0).
This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(ab224696).
